Is Joe Goldberg a sociopath or a psychopath?
According to Healthline, the term “psychosis” is not a widely accepted clinical term or diagnosis. People often use it to refer to antisocial personality disorder (ASPD). According to Mayo Clinic, ASPD “is sometimes referred to as a social disease, a mental health condition in which a person always ignores the rights and feelings of others without considering right or wrong.”
People with antisocial personality disorders often deliberately make others angry or upset, manipulate those around them or treat them indifferently. They lack remorse, often violate the law, and become criminals.
Joe often breaks the law and ignores the feelings of the people he is obsessed with. He often doesn’t regret his deeds, such as when he killed Guinvere’s boyfriend Benji in Season 1. However, the characters cannot be diagnosed in a clean way. During the show, the incident described Joe being vandalized after his landlord’s death or refusing to kill Forty due to the importance of love for Joe’s partner. This shows that the character does have some empathy. So, Joe Goldberg is a complex character that is difficult to adapt in a diagnosis.
Kelly Scott, the therapist at Tribeca Therapy in Manhattan, told Business Insider in an interview that Joe may have an attachment disorder due to childhood trauma. “Joe would be a great example of a misdiagnosis,” Scott said.
Joe Goldberg is in you
The character initially began his journey at a bookstore in New York. When he was obsessed with one of the customers Guinvere, he began to manipulate the incident to appear in her life. This led to a series of events where Joe killed, lying and stalking those near Geneville to cement his status as a boyfriend. Throughout the season, Joe is attracted to different women, but his obsession and violent tendencies are obstacles to his happiness with any of them.
